On the first full day of Comic-Con, BioWare held their usual BioWare Base get together outside of the event for fans and the press. Here are a few highlights from the first day:

BioWare Base Event 7/12

  • A new hoodie from Jinx is on the way including twenty other products
  • The new novel Annihilation mentioned
  • Epic questlines where players can gain legendary-like weapons from them are in the works
  • New story content coming in the next "year or so"
  • New operation content will not make prior operations obsolete, BioWare will keep itemization in mind as new content makes its way to the game
  • BioWare looks at metrics of what you're playing (Warzones, Operations) or doing in the game for future patches
  • BioWare loves minigames, something for the future
  • Will continue to add space missions and more features to it in the future
